What is Google Maps Scraping?
Google Maps Scraping is the process of using Google Maps business listings as your primary data source for outbound B2B sales and marketing campaigns.
Instead of buying stale lead lists from data brokers or relying on unpredictable referrals, you extract fresh, verified business information directly from online Google Maps, the most accurate, up-to-date registry of local businesses in the world.
Why Online Google Maps are the Best Lead Source:
1. Verified, Active Businesses
- Google Maps require stringent verification (video proof, postcards, phone verification)
- Businesses must be actively operating to maintain their listing
- Fake or closed businesses are removed quickly
2. Real-Time Data
- Business owners update their profiles constantly
- Phone numbers and websites are current (customers use them daily)
- Hours, addresses, and services are accurate
3. Rich Engagement Metrics
- Review count indicates business size and activity
- Star ratings show quality and customer satisfaction
- Recent reviews prove the business is active
- Photo counts demonstrate engagement level
4. Complete Market Coverage
- Nearly 100% of local businesses with physical locations
- Includes businesses not on LinkedIn or in B2B databases
- Covers every industry and niche
5. Geographic Targeting
- Precise location data for hyper-local campaigns
- Service area information
- Neighborhood and zip code filtering
The Data You Can Extract:
From each Google Maps listing:
- Business name
- Full address (street, city, state, zip)
- Phone number
- Website URL
- Star rating (1-5 stars)
- Total review count
From the business website (via automated crawling):
- Email addresses
- LinkedIn profiles
- Additional contact information
- Services offered
- Team member names

Multi-Extraction: Generate 100s of Leads in One Hour
The real power of Google Maps Scraping comes from multi-extraction—running multiple searches back-to-back to build massive lead lists quickly.
How Multi-Extraction Works
Instead of extracting one search at a time, PinLeads lets you queue up multiple query searches and run them sequentially. Here's the process:
Step 1: Plan Your Searches
Identify 5-10 different search variations for your target market. For example, if you're targeting restaurants:
- "restaurants in [city]"
- "Italian restaurants in [city]"
- "Mexican restaurants in [city]"
- "Asian restaurants in [city]"
- "fine dining restaurants in [city]"
- "family restaurants in [city]"
- "seafood restaurants in [city]"
- "steakhouse in [city]"
Step 2: Set Up Your Multi-Extraction
With PinLeads:
- Type your qeuries into the PinLeads dashboard.
- Click 'Extract' results (typically 20-120 businesses per search)
- Export to CSV or connect HubSpot / Zapier for automated outreach
Step 3: The Numbers
Here's what you can expect in one hour:
- 8 searches × 80 businesses per search = 640 leads
- 70% have websites = 448 websites to crawl
- 60% of websites yield emails = 269 email addresses
Total: 640 qualified leads with 269 emails in 60 minutes
Why This Works So Well
1. Comprehensive Coverage Different search queries surface different businesses. A restaurant might appear under "restaurants" but not "Italian restaurants"—or vice versa. By running multiple related searches, you capture the full market.
2. Rapid Volume Traditional manual extraction: 1 search per 5 minutes = 12 searches/hour PinLeads multi-extraction: 1 search per 3-4 minutes = 15-20 searches/hour
3. Zero Incremental Cost Whether you scrape 100 leads or 1,000 leads, your cost is the same flat subscription. No per-lead fees mean you can scale without worrying about costs.
4. Fresh Data Directory data is real-time. When you multi-extract, you're getting the most current business information available—no stale data from months-old lists.
Real-World Example
Target: Dentists in Chicago
Searches to run:
- "dentists in Chicago"
- "dental clinic Chicago"
- "orthodontist Chicago"
- "cosmetic dentist Chicago"
- "pediatric dentist Chicago"
- "emergency dentist Chicago"
- "family dentist Chicago"
- "dental implants Chicago"
Results in 45 minutes:
- 8 searches × 95 businesses = 760 leads
- 532 websites found
- 342 email addresses extracted
- All exported to CSV, ready for outreach
Tips for Effective Multi-Extraction
Vary Your Search Terms
- Use synonyms ("plumber" vs "plumbing contractor")
- Include service-specific terms ("emergency plumber", "residential plumber")
- Try location modifiers ("near me", "in [neighborhood]")
Filter by Quality
- Focus on businesses with 10+ reviews (indicates active business)
- Target 4+ star ratings (higher quality prospects)
- Check for recent activity (new reviews in last 3 months)
Organize Your Data
- Export each search to its own CSV for tracking
- Merge all files into a master list
- Remove duplicates (businesses appearing in multiple searches)
- Segment by search type for targeted outreach
